So here is what I remember frm my interview-
It was for 1:15 hrs ( I met couple of people who have it for 2 hrs...
)
Two people from adcom mostly usual question and deep dive into each.. tell me about yourself... why mba.. why now... wht post mba...practical aspects like funding and then detailed discussion on each... what they wish to understand is whether u are a fit to their school or not ...there is no set profile ... please don't try to mug up the facts ..they know how to get u in tht ..just be aware abt it..
I think wht I learnt frm my experience was be honest... know what u wish to do now and post mba ... whether achievable or not be realistic abt it..open abt it.. in case you wish to change your mind post mba... they will help you.. meet them if possible.. speak with an alumni... it helps trust me ..not for application for knowing the school ...and in the end if you can enjoy the conversation in your interview and you learn something about the other person, urself and school ..that's all interviews are for
